Was Türkiye oblivious to the impending disaster?
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Scientists say that it is impossible to make predictions about an earthquake before it happens. But the question whether it is still valid has been raised. That is with the strong earthquake of magnitude 7.8 that occurred in Turkiye early yesterday morning.

Frank Hoogerbeets, a Dutch researcher, made a prediction on his Twitter account a few days ago, on the 3rd of February.

“Sooner or later there will be an earthquake of ~7.5 M in this region (South-Central Turkey, Jordan, Syria, Lebanon),” he wrote on his Twitter account.

The prediction published by Dutch researcher Frank Hoogerbeets has been heavily discussed on social media due to the fact that he correctly recorded it 03 days before the earthquake in Turkey.

After that, Frank Hoogerbeets once again tweeted that there is a possibility of strong aftershocks in the region, including Turkiye.

Sooner or later there will be a ~M 7.5 #earthquake in this region (South-Central Turkey, Jordan, Syria, Lebanon). #deprem pic.twitter.com/6CcSnjJmCV

— Frank Hoogerbeets (@hogrbe) February 3, 2023

My heart goes out to everyone affected by the major earthquake in Central Turkey.

As I stated earlier, sooner or later this would happen in this region, similar to the years 115 and 526. These earthquakes are always preceded by critical planetary geometry, as we had on 4-5 Feb.

— Frank Hoogerbeets (@hogrbe) February 6, 2023
